Summary/Abstract: Organizational culture is a complex and important concept in the management of all organizations, with a role in highlighting the values, norms, behaviours, and way of thinking, as well as the interaction between the members of the organization and the fulfilment of the established objectives. The continuous evolution of society determines the progress of each individual organization, both economically and socially. Organizational culture is increasingly present in all economic, social, and cultural branches, improving the way of working, and contributing to the increase of expectations regarding social requirements, the content of work, and the quality of the workplace. In the development of human resources within an organization, organizational culture has an important role, as it can support this aspect, leading to good organization and increasing the efficiency of the organization; the more perfected the human resources will be, the more their efficiency will increase and, thus, the good functioning of the organization in general. This article aims to highlight, through the literature review, the importance of organizational culture within an organization for human resources and, thus, for the organization.
